Summary

During public comment the town heard calls to add trash receptacles, an accessible toilet and dark‑sky‑compliant lighting to the ongoing Tom Moore restoration project and for caution about how a proposed conservation easement could create nonconforming uses.

Residents used the citizen‑input segment of the Sept. 10 council meeting to press the town for practical changes to the Tom Moore restoration project and to flag potential long‑term consequences of a proposed conservation easement.
